Definitions
To redeem inappropriately; to convert to cash under invalid circumstances.
Examples
“With today's sophisticated copying machines, one of the easiest ways to misredeem coupons is simply through duplication and gang cutting.”
“Trying to stimulate the sales of a less popular size or variety of a brand, for example, by issuing a coupon redeemable 'only' against that size or variety, will very often fail simply because too many consumers will misredeem the coupon against the most popular size/variety.”
“Ecover reserves the right to refuse payment against misredeemed vouchers.”
“The difficulty is that retailers can misredeem the discount delivery vehicle (e.g., coupon) without a redemption, that is submit coupons for redemption that were not submitted by consumers with purchases.”
